Cost of Egress Window Repair in Charleston
The cost of egress window repair in Charleston, SC, can vary significantly depending on several factors. Egress windows are essential for safety, providing an escape route in case of emergencies and ensuring compliance with local building codes. Whether you're dealing with minor repairs or a full replacement, understanding the factors that influence the cost can help you budget more effectively.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Window Size: Larger windows typically require more materials and labor, leading to higher costs.
- Window Type: Different types of egress windows (e.g., casement, sliding) have varying prices.
- Material Quality: Higher-quality materials can increase the cost but offer better durability.
- Labor Rates: Labor costs in Charleston, SC, can fluctuate based on the contractor's experience and demand.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the overall cost.
- Accessibility: Hard-to-reach locations may require specialized equipment or additional labor.
- Extent of Damage: More extensive damage will generally lead to higher repair costs.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Charleston, SC) |
---|---|
Minor Crack Repair | $150 - $300 |
Frame Replacement | $400 - $700 |
Glass Pane Replacement | $200 - $500 |
Full Window Replacement | $1,000 - $2,500 |
Waterproofing and Sealing | $300 - $600 |
Permits and Inspections | $50 - $200 |
